Buying a home is an exciting journey, but it’s important to understand the timeline involved. While every transaction is unique, this guide outlines a typical home-buying process from pre-approval to move-in day, common delays, and how a real estate agent can help streamline the process.
Step 1: Pre-Approval for a Mortgage (1–2 Weeks)
Before you start house hunting, get pre-approved for a mortgage.
What Happens:
Gather financial documents like tax returns, pay stubs, and bank statements.
Submit them to a lender, who will assess your creditworthiness and determine your loan amount.
Why It’s Important: Pre-approval shows sellers you’re a serious buyer and helps you focus on homes within your budget.
How an Agent Helps: They can recommend reputable lenders and guide you through the pre-approval process efficiently.
Step 2: House Hunting (2–8 Weeks)
This step varies depending on your preferences, market conditions, and availability of suitable homes.
What Happens:
View homes that meet your criteria in Anna, TX.
Visit open houses and schedule private showings.
Refine your priorities based on what you see.
How an Agent Helps: A real estate agent uses local expertise to find homes that match your needs and budget, saving you time.
Step 3: Making an Offer and Negotiation (1–2 Weeks)
Once you find the right home, it’s time to make an offer.
What Happens:
Submit an offer through your agent, which may include contingencies like inspections or financing approval.
Negotiate with the seller on price, terms, or repairs.
How an Agent Helps: Agents handle negotiations on your behalf, ensuring you get the best deal while addressing any contingencies.
Step 4: Inspection and Appraisal (2–3 Weeks)
After your offer is accepted, schedule a home inspection and appraisal.
What Happens:
Inspection: Identifies any issues with the property, like structural problems or repairs needed.
Appraisal: Confirms the home’s value aligns with the purchase price for the lender.
How an Agent Helps: Agents coordinate with inspectors and appraisers, review reports with you, and negotiate repairs if needed.
Step 5: Loan Processing and Underwriting (3–6 Weeks)
This is the behind-the-scenes step where the lender finalizes your loan.
What Happens:
Provide additional documents if requested by the lender.
Wait for the underwriting process to confirm your financial ability to repay the loan.
Common Delays: Missing documents or financial changes (e.g., opening new credit accounts) can slow this step.
How an Agent Helps: Agents ensure you stay on track by advising you on what to avoid during this phase and keeping communication open with your lender.
Step 6: Closing Day (1–2 Days)
Closing is when you finalize the purchase and take ownership of your new home.
What Happens:
Review and sign closing documents.
Pay closing costs (usually 2%–5% of the home price).
Receive the keys to your new home.
How an Agent Helps: Agents review documents with you to ensure accuracy and accompany you to closing for support.
Step 7: Move-In Day! (1 Week or More)
The final step is moving into your new home.
What Happens:
Set up utilities, unpack, and settle into your new space.
Address any immediate repairs or updates.
How an Agent Helps: Post-closing, agents can connect you with local contractors, movers, and other resources to make your move smoother.
Planning for Unexpected Delays
Inspection Issues: Significant repairs or disagreements about who covers the cost can delay the timeline.
Solution: Work with your agent to negotiate effectively.
Appraisal Problems: If the appraisal comes in lower than the offer price, financing may be delayed.
Solution: Agents help renegotiate the price or identify alternatives to cover the gap.
Loan Approval Delays: Missing paperwork or last-minute changes can slow the underwriting process.
Solution: Submit all required documents promptly and avoid major financial changes.
Typical Home Buying Timeline Recap
Step | Timeframe |
Pre-Approval | 1–2 Weeks |
House Hunting | 2–8 Weeks |
Offer and Negotiation | 1–2 Weeks |
Inspection and Appraisal | 2–3 Weeks |
Loan Processing and Underwriting | 3–6 Weeks |
Closing | 1–2 Days |
Total | ~8–12 Weeks or More |
